sign
sign of the times something typical of the nature or quality of a particular period, typically something undesirable.
sign on the dotted line agree formally.
1921P. G. WodehouseIndiscretions of Archie I spoke to him as one old friend to another…and he sang a few bars from 'Rigoletto', and signed on the dotted line.
sign your own death warrant do something that ensures your own demise or downfall.
sign the pledge: seepledge.
signed, sealed, and delivered (or signed and sealed) formally and officially agreed and in effect.
